The Therapeutic Behavioral Services (TBS) Supervisor for Riverside County is responsible for overseeing and managing the TBS program, ensuring quality service and continual improvement in the therapeutic behavioral supports. This role involves supervising TBS Coaches. The TBS Coach may provide direct services to youth and families as needed.Compensation and Benefits:The pay range we’re offering is $75,000- $90,000 annually depending on experience.Medical, Dental, and Vision Insurance- we offer a company-defined contribution of $580/monthLife InsuranceFlexible Spending AccountPaid Time OffSick TimePaid Holidays403(b) retirement plan with company match up to 3%Employee Assistance ProgramTuition ReimbursementEmployee Referral BonusCredit Union MembershipTraining Opportunities to Further Personal and Professional GrowthQualifications:Master’s Degree in Social Work, Counseling and/or Psychology.Licensed by the California Board of Behavioral Sciences as an LMFT, LCSW or LPCC.A minimum of 5 years of experience working in RUBHS-contracted mental health settings.Must be qualified to supervise TBS coaches.Experience in providing applied behavioral analysis services is highly desired.Word Processing, Email, internet, ability to learn clinical software, basic office skills (i.e. typing, telephone, copier)Must pass pre-employment physical exam, TB and drug screeningAbility to commute to various community sites and homes.Ability to work extended hours as neededA valid Driver’s License and reliable transportation is required.DOJ, FBI, Child Abuse IndexInsurability Under Corporate Automobile InsuranceKey Responsibilities:Ensure the TBS Department is in full regulatory compliance and that therapeutic behavioral services are delivered in accordance with recognized best practices.Conduct functional behavioral assessments, analyze information, and evaluate new cases and/or revise treatment plans when necessary, in accordance with county and agency requirements and practices.Facilitate monthly treatment team meetings with the client’s primary therapist, caregiver and other meaningful members of the treatment team.Distribute referred cases to coaches in accordance with program objectives and goals, assuring that the identified caregiver, program liaisons and coaches receive quality customer service and timely follow up regarding assignment, treatment needs and progress of services.Oversee training and performance of coaches, coordinate meetings and approve administrative and clinical documentation.Coordinate and conduct weekly supervision of TBS Coaches.Work with Riverside County TBS Liaison in the areas of service authorizations, audits, weekly services report, quarterly service report, training (as assigned) and Quarterly meetings (as assigned)Participate in the interviewing and hiring of coaches as needed.Provide other administrative and/or supervisory responsibilities as assigned.Demonstrate an ability to set limits and intervene appropriately to meet the needs of the children and families served.Work with other Department managers to increase clear communication and mutual support between programs.Monitor and assure adherence of programs to all governing bodies.Monitor care records to assure that required treatment documentation is included and meets agency and professional standards.Actively participate in the agency’s Continuous Quality Improvement (CQI) Plan.Assume responsibility for quality control and outcome measures as assigned.Other related duties as assigned.Why Should You Apply?Our Mission- work for an organization that makes a real difference in people’s livesCompetitive paySeveral benefit optionsEmployee tuition reimbursementGreat training for staffJoin McKinley to Be Your Best H.U.M.A.N.McKinley’s response to COVID-19:
